I'm going to be reading from Philippians chapter 4 verse 4 through 7.
I'll get you a Bible and let's read along.
Rejoice in the Lord always.
Again I say rejoice.
Let your reasonableness be known to everyone.
The Lord is at hand.
Do not be anxious about anything,
But in everything by prayer and supplication with thanksgiving let your requests be made known to God.
In the peace of God which surpasses all understanding will guard your hearts and minds in Christ Jesus.

You know the Bible as you read it you come to find out that the Bible hardly talks about happiness.
The Bible hardly says be happy and you don't hear that a lot.
The Bible talks a lot about joy.
You know happiness,
Being happy,
Is based on things happening,
Happenstance,
Things happening.
But the Bible doesn't say that.
The Bible talks about joy.
Rejoice.
Well what's joy?
Well we already talked about happiness,
Things happening you know based on you know happenstance.
But joy is a soul that knows that it's secured in Christ.
It doesn't matter what is happening right now because their soul is already secured in Christ.
Through the work of Christ on the cross.
And so no matter what happens or what is happening right now they're not concerned about that.
Oh it may seem very very troubling.
But they're not worried about that because they've got deep joy within them.
Their joy is based on the finished work of Christ on the cross.
And so when the apostle says rejoice and again I say rejoice.
That's where he's coming from.
